Essential Tools for a Professional Henna Artist

To achieve beautiful henna designs, a talented artist requires more than just pigment. Obtaining the right tools is key for consistent results. Beyond basic cones, consider a selection of tools like fine-tipped applicator bottles, multiple sized piping bags, and premium brushes for shading larger areas. A well-made stencil set can also be advantageous for those learning or for executing symmetrical patterns. Finally, don’t forget basic supplies like tissues for removing mistakes and alcohol for surface sanitization.

Mobile Henna Artist Setup: Tips & Tricks

Setting up the mobile henna operation requires thoughtful planning. To begin, invest in sturdy carrying cases for the supplies. Think about brightness; the adjustable clip-on lamp is essential for accurate placement. Don't forget a sanitary workspace – a fold-out table with layered coverings is perfect . Finally, ensure you have all of required – from applicators to disinfectant – before heading your appointment .
